About the Role
As a Senior Manufacturing Engineer at MKS, you will partner with the NPI Team and Engineering to develop and implement manufacturing processes for electromechanical parts, sub-assemblies, and final assemblies for new product development. You will report to the Senior Manufacturing Engineering Manager.
Responsibilities
- Transition products from Design to LCC Manufacturing centers.
- Represent the Technical Operations team in product development projects, communicating requirements and proposing solutions.
- Partner with design engineering and facilitate supplier value engineering in product development with strong influence in DFX (Design for Manufacturing, Assembly, and Service).
- Define and establish manufacturing methods, processes, and tools to streamline new and existing products.
- Review designs of PCBA’s, cables, metal, and magnetics for production manufacturability.
- Design and procure assembly tools and fixtures.
- Create, update, and maintain manufacturing process instructions.
- Structure product BOM’s and establish routings with associated labor standards.
- Coordinate product transfers to manufacturing.
- Support daily production demand.
